Output 662d76f6e947a01473e4b6b26b928d78e81e5d40cb7afcfffe1e6883eb8fe5c7:23

value
5481714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25e74beaa3dab45760861ff84af035fa162f9ab2 OP_EQUAL
address
359S1QaujAErHtVVcMNePat42ZJye8buuY
transaction
662d76f6e947a01473e4b6b26b928d78e81e5d40cb7afcfffe1e6883eb8fe5c7
confirmations
275690
spent
true